Lorsque j'importe une photo de mon PC vers Lightroom,j'ai la réponse "Impossible de copier un fichier vers le dossier de destination car il n'est pas accessible en écriture ou il n'y a pas d'espace libre-Eléments 1-100-Eléments 101-134".donc impossible d'importer,ce qui est nouveau pour moi.C'est la 1ère fois que cela m'arrive et j'ai pourtant augmenté ma capacité de stockage : de 20 G à 1 To.Comment débloquer la situation ?

The error message is suggesting that you may need to provide Read and Write permission for the destination folder that you are attempting to move/copy the image files to during the import process. You will need to use your operating system to make the adjustment, or select a different destination folder.
